AVGO vs SMCI: by the numbers
- •AVGO is the larger company ($1.81T vs $18.40B market cap).
- •SMCI trades at the lower trailing earnings multiple (15.77 vs 63.87 P/E), one valuation lens rather than an overall verdict.
- •AVGO converts more revenue to profit (38.85% vs 3.70% net margin).
- •SMCI grew revenue faster over the past five years (58.36% vs 24.17% CAGR).
- •AVGO pays a dividend (0.66% yield), while SMCI has no payments in the available dividend history.
